Ace
was the puppy I kept from Gem's second litter. The
biggest puppy in his litter, Ace matured into a large,
beautiful male with excellent structure and movement, and
a full, beautiful coat. He finished his show
championship easily. The highlight of his show
career was winning First Place in the Bred-By-Exhibitor class
at the 1997 Belgian Sheepdog Club of America National
Specialty under judge Anne Rogers Clark, over some very
stiff competition. I was so proud! Ace is
also a very powerful herding dog. Now retired, he enjoys
being a homebody and is very serious about his role
as Protector of my house and farm.
